A 1-L round-bottom flask was charged with 28.0 g (0.0968 mol) of crude compound of Example 2, 15.21 g (0.1006 mol) of 3-nitrobenzaldehyde and 400 mL of methanol. The mixture was stirred until a solution was obtained. To this solution was added 40.13 g (0.2903 mol) of powdered potassium carbonate under vigorous stirring and stirring was continued overnight at room temperature. The compound of Example 2 was no longer detectable at this time (TLC, Merck silica gel 60, F-254; 95:5 ethyl acetate methanol). During the reaction time additional solids had precipitated from the solution. The suspension was concentrated at 30° C. bath temperature and 10 torr until a volume of about 200 mL of methanol was removed. To the resulting residue was added 200 mL of water and the mixture was stirred at room temperature for one hour. The solids were collected by filtration under reduced pressure using a sintered-glass funnel of medium porosity. The filter cake was washed with 2×100 mL of water and dried for 16 hours at 30° C. and 10 torr over potassium hydroxide flakes to afford 26.63 g of crude [E]-4-cyclobutyl-2-[2-(3-nitrophenyl)ethenyl]thiazole as a mustard-colored powder (TLC, Merck silica gel 60, F-254; 95:5 ethyl acetate-methanol); 96.1% yield based on crude compound of Example 2 used, 96.76% pure (HPLC).
